from django.core.paginator import EmptyPage, PageNotAnInteger, Paginator
views.py
feedTextAll = feedText.objects.order_by('-feedTexDate')
pages = Paginator(feedTextAll,5)
pageNum = request.GET.get('page')
feedtext = pages.get_page(pageNum)
return render(request, 'index.html',{'feedtext':feedtext})
{% for feedtext in feedtext%}
<!--- Display your records here--!>
{% endfor %}
<!--- displaying page numbers at bottom --!>
<ul class="pagination justify-content-center" style="margin:20px 0">
{% if feedtext.has_previous %}
<li class="page-item"><a class="page-link" href="?page=1"><<</a></li>
<li class="page-item"><a class="page-link" href="?page={{feedtext.previous_page_number}}"><</a></li>
{%else%}
<li class="page-item disabled"><a class="page-link" href="#"><<</a></li>
<li class="page-item disabled"><a class="page-link" href="#"><</a></li>
{% endif %}
{%for num in feedtext.paginator.page_range %}
{% if feedtext.number == num %}
<li class="page-item text-bold active"><a class="page-link" href="?page={{num}}">{{num}}</a></li>
{%endif%}
{% endfor %}
{% if feedtext.has_next %}
<li class="page-item"><a class="page-link" href="?page={{feedtext.next_page_number}}">></a></li>
<li class="page-item"><a class="page-link" href="?page={{feedtext.paginator.num_pages}}">>></a></li>
{%else%}
<li class="page-item disabled"><a class="page-link" href="#">></a></li>
<li class="page-item disabled"><a class="page-link" href="#">>></a></li>
{%endif%}
</ul>